Output 26af40fba3cd7d13b5997656007851380e43357f233c109e24cfef954822000f:0

value
328575082
script pubkey
OP_0 OP_PUSHBYTES_20 93c9a39c34710849c7e76060b918f3519599e387
address
ltc1qj0y688p5wyyyn3l8vpstjx8n2x2encu890945e
transaction
26af40fba3cd7d13b5997656007851380e43357f233c109e24cfef954822000f
spent
true